Dreyfuss Family Collection; Mannheim
Scope and Content Note
Documents and correspondence pertaining to the Dreyfuss family from Mannheim, the descendents of Elias Hayum. All documents are photocopies of originals.
Folder 3 contains citizenship papers, various official receipts of purchase, letters of recognition relating to the Jewish orphanage, a description of a golden goblet which was in possession of the Dreyfuss family, and postcards from the Dachau concentration camp.
